Sport: Runningby FoukLocation: Alcala de Henares / EspañaDistance: 3.58 miles - 5.76 km
No description/comment from Fouk
View route Messaging
Route overview - Print this route - Download this route as GPX & KMLAdd this route to your site
Sport: Runningby FoukLocation: Alcala de Henares / EspañaDistance: 3.60 miles - 5.79 km
Sport: Runningby FoukLocation: Alcala de Henares / EspañaDistance: 2.60 miles - 4.18 km
Enter your route ID to edit:
Enter your route ID to delete: Password:
Recover a forgotten password